Gift Shops Cumbernauld

Cumbernauld Village Flower Shop

Address
64 Main Street
The Village
Place
G67 2RX Cumbernauld

Description

Cumbernauld Village Flower Shop can be found at 64 Main Street . The following is offered: Gift Shops, Florists, Wedding Supplies & Services, Gift Services & Gift Packs - In Cumbernauld there are 2 other Gift Shops.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Gift Shops, Florists, Wedding Supplies & Services, Gift Services & Gift Packs

Map 64 Main Street